Layout: Single columns of 19 lines. Catchword on each verso.
Script: Naskh.
Decoration: Rubrication including frames.
Binding: Flap binding, brown leather over paper pasteboards, with blind-tooled central mandorla and frames; marbled and blank paper pastedowns.
Accompanied by notes containing Bereket Duası (prayer for barakah) (2 leaves).
Contemporary manuscript Persian-Ottoman Turkish wordlist (front pastedown, f. 1a, verso rear flyleaf). Contemporary manuscript annotations (f. 198b) including a table of contents, a note stating that this manuscript was read in the mansion of el-Ḥācī Seyyid Aḥmed ʻAġā, in the room of İbrāhīm ʻAġā. Later manuscript notes of title (f. 2a, rear pastedown).
